Cardinal Konrad Krajewski is a Polish prelate of the Catholic Church, known for his role as the papal almoner, responsible for charitable activities on behalf of the Pope. He has gained recognition for his humanitarian efforts, particularly in conflict zones, and has made multiple trips to Ukraine to deliver medical supplies and aid. His recent involvement includes leading the delivery of four ambulances equipped with essential medical instruments to support those affected by the ongoing war in Ukraine.

Born on Nov 25, 1963 (61 years old)
